Expensive but convenient
From: -Anonymous-Date posted: 9/10/2004
Years at this apartment: 2004 - 2004
We moved in mid-July after living in Europe for 4 years.
Yes, it's expensive. So's France. But what in the DC Metro area isn't'
Yes, the staff appear to be malfunctioning androids much of the time. But as long as they fix broken stuff and keep the lights on, I'm happy.
My biggest complaint involves access to the community gas grill (they close it at 6 pm). So I bought a George Foreman Grill and now cook my burgers in the apartment.
Bottomline: I'm not sweatin' the small stuff. If you want unbelievable convenience and a less than 5 minute commute to the Pentagon, then consider Warwick House apartments. It'll cost you. But you knew that when you moved to Emerald City.
